Why Consulting and Research at Gallup

For decades, Gallup has helped organizations answer some of the most important questions about work: What drives employee engagement? What makes a great manager? How do organizations build thriving cultures? How can organizations identify and select people who will succeed?

The answers have inspired workplace practices around the world and informed some of Gallup's most recognized research, products and consulting services. As a senior consultant with expertise in workplace science, you'll contribute to the next generation of discoveries.

Gallup offers research opportunities few organizations can match:

  • Access to unique historical and longitudinal datasets on employee engagement, talent-based selection, organizational culture, wellbeing, leadership development and employee experience that few researchers will encounter elsewhere in their careers
  • Opportunities to contribute to thought leadership, publications and client insights that influence leaders around the world
  • Collaboration with researchers, consultants and subject-matter experts who are committed to turning evidence into meaningful workplace change
  • A culture that encourages curiosity, innovation and exploration of emerging methods, technologies and AI-enabled approaches to research

What You’ll Do

  • Partner with clients and internal stakeholders to define business challenges, develop research strategies and lead the successful execution of client engagements
  • Design and oversee quantitative and qualitative research that generates actionable insights for clients
  • Translate sophisticated analyses into strategic recommendations that inform executive decision-making
  • Lead client meetings, presentations, workshops and webinars
  • Build trusted relationships with senior client stakeholders while serving as a strategic adviser throughout the research and consulting process
  • Mentor and develop junior researchers by providing technical guidance, coaching and quality oversight across projects
  • Contribute to Gallup's regional thought leadership through original research, publications, workplace reports and innovative client solutions
  • Use AI-enabled tools to enhance research quality, accelerate insight generation and improve client outcomes

What You Need

  • Master's degree in industrial-organizational psychology, organizational behavior, psychology, business, statistics, research methodology or a related field required; Ph.D. preferred
  • At least eight years of experience in workplace research, organizational consulting, people analytics or applied behavioral science required
  • Demonstrated expertise conducting advanced quantitative and qualitative research, including driver analysis, statistical modeling, longitudinal research and qualitative synthesis required
  • Proven experience designing and presenting executive-level research plans, insights and recommendations to senior client audiences required
  • Experience leading large, complex client engagements and coordinating cross-functional project teams under competing priorities required
  • Demonstrated ability to translate business challenges into rigorous research designs and actionable recommendations required
  • Deep experience with survey design, implementation and reporting platforms such as Gallup Access or comparable enterprise research platforms required
  • Experience mentoring researchers, consultants or project team members required
  • Demonstrated use of AI tools to improve research, analysis, productivity and client deliverables required
  • Experience contributing to thought leadership through publications, workplace reports or conference presentations preferred
  • A commitment to working on-site at Gallup's Singapore office at least three days per week required
